Package: wnpp Severity: wishlist X-Debbugs-CC: pkg-ruby-extras-maintain...@lists.alioth.debian.org Hi all, I tested the redmine_agile plugin on a Debian stretch system. I put notes about my experience with it here: https://github.com/dpocock/redmine_agile/blob/master/Debian_Install.txt and if anybody can give feedback about the process I used that would be really helpful to anybody who tries to make a package. Notice that the plugin includes a few hundred lines of non-free JavaScript and until that is resolved it can't go into main. The Ruby part of the plugin is GPLv2 code. It also depends on one library, redmine_crm, which is also GPLv2 Regards, Daniel

Bug#888891: ITP: odp -- OpenDataPlane reference implementation library
Package: wnpp Severity: wishlist Owner: Dmitry Eremin-Solenikov* Package name: odp Version : 1.17.0.0 Upstream Author : Linaro * URL : http://www.opendataplane.org/ * License : BSD 3-clause Programming Lang: C Description : OpenDataPlane reference implementation library OpenDataPlane (ODP) project is an open-source, cross-platform set of application programming interfaces (APIs) for the networking software defined data plane. ODP embraces and extends existing proprietary, optimized vendor-specific hardware blocks and software libraries to provide interoperability with minimal overhead. I'm one of contributors to the ODP project, so packaging will be maintained closely with package upstream. Wartan Hachaturov agreed to be a sponsor for this package. -- With best wishes Dmitry

Bug#888856: ITP: r-cran-truncdist -- GNU R Functions for extreme value distributions
Package: wnpp Severity: wishlist Owner: Sébastien Villemot* Package name: r-cran-truncdist Version : 1.0-2 Upstream Author : Frederick Novomestky * URL : https://cran.r-project.org/package=truncdist * License : GPL-2+ Programming Lang: GNU R Description : GNU R Functions for extreme value distributions A collection of tools to evaluate probability density functions, cumulative distribution functions, quantile functions and random numbers for truncated random variables. These functions are provided to also compute the expected value and variance. Nadarajah and Kotz (2006) developed most of the functions. QQ plots can be produced. All the probability functions in the stats, stats4 and evd packages are automatically available for truncation. Bug#888823: ITP: with-simulated-input-el -- macro to simulate user input non-interactively
Package: wnpp Owner: Lev LamberovSeverity: wishlist * Package name: with-simulated-input-el Version : 2.2 Upstream Author : Ryan C. Thompson * URL or Web page : https://github.com/DarwinAwardWinner/with-simulated-input * License : GPL-3+ Programming Lang: Emacs Lisp Description : macro to simulate user input non-interactively This package provides an Emacs Lisp macro, `with-simulated-input', which evaluates one or more forms while simulating a sequence of input events for those forms to read. The result is the same as if you had evaluated the forms and then manually typed in the same input. This macro is useful for non-interactive testing of normally interactive commands and functions, such as `completing-read'.

Bug#888814: ITP: dde-qt5integration -- Qt5 theme integration for Deepin application
Package: wnpp Severity: wishlist Owner: Boyuan Yang <073p...@gmail.com> X-Debbugs-CC: debian-de...@lists.debian.org * Package name: dde-qt5integration Version : 0.2.8.3 Upstream Author : Deepin Technology Co., Ltd. * URL : https://github.com/linuxdeepin/qt5integration * License : GPL-3+ Programming Lang: C++/Qt Description : Qt5 theme integration for Deepin application Deepin's qt5integration provides a library plugin used by Deepin application and Deepin Desktop Enviroment. It implements many extra features on top of stock Qt, include hijacking window decoration / shadow painting, better support for cursors under HiDPI, retrieval of full list of windows under current workspace, support for window of arbitrary shape with anti-aliasing and so on.
